Daing Mohamad Nafiz Daing Idris
Researcher at Universiti Malaysia Pahang
Publications - 16
Citations - 316
Daing Mohamad Nafiz Daing Idris is an academic researcher from Universiti Malaysia Pahang. The author has contributed to research in topics: Electricity generation & Finite element method. The author has an hindex of 6, co-authored 16 publications receiving 215 citations.

A new dewatering technique for stingless bees honey
Ahmad Syazwan Ramli,Firdaus Basrawi,Daing Mohamad Nafiz Daing Idris,Mohd Hazwan bin Yusof,Thamir K. Ibrahim,Zulkifli Mustafa,Shaharin A. Sulaiman +6 more
TL;DR: In this paper, a new method of honey dewatering was developed using a Low Temperature Vacuum Drying (LTVD) with induced nucleation technique, which improved the water removal rate significantly with an average of 0.15% of water content per minute.
